Understanding Steel Reinforced Plastic Rebar Steel reinforced plastic rebar is a composite material that combines the durability of steel with the lightweight, corrosion-resistant properties of plastic. This innovative rebar is designed to provide the same tensile strength as traditional steel rebar, making it suitable for various applications in construction, including bridges, roads, and buildings. The benefits of SRP rebar extend beyond strength; the material is also resistant to rust, making it ideal for projects in harsh environments or where traditional rebar would suffer from corrosion. The Role of Safety Caps Amidst the numerous advantages presented by SRP rebar, the addition of safety caps plays a critical role in ensuring safety on construction sites. Safety caps are protective coverings that fit over the exposed ends of rebar, preventing injuries caused by sharp ends, which can pose serious hazards to workers. These injuries can range from minor cuts to more severe accidents that can significantly impact project timelines and worker morale. Preventing Injuries steel reinforced plastic rebar safety cap Accident statistics in the construction industry reveal that tripping, falling, or coming into contact with protruding rebar significantly contributes to work-related injuries. Metal rebar ends can be particularly dangerous as they can puncture skin and cause deep wounds. Safety caps help mitigate this risk by providing a barrier that covers the sharp edges of rebar, reducing the likelihood of accidental contact. Moreover, these caps can be brightly colored, enhancing visibility and alerting workers to potential hazards in their environment. The Critical Role of the Main Water Shut-Off Valve In the intricate network that supplies water to our homes and businesses, one component plays a pivotal role the main water shut-off valve. This unassuming piece of plumbing hardware is often overlooked until the moment it is needed most. Its importance cannot be understated, as it serves as the primary control point for the flow of water into a property. The main water shut-off valve is typically located where the water supply line enters your home or building. It is generally found near the street or in a basement or utility room. In newer constructions, it may be housed in an underground box with a removable lid to protect it from freezing and damage. Identifying and understanding how this valve functions can save you from potential flooding and costly repairs should a plumbing emergency occur. When a pipe bursts or there's a leak in your plumbing system, the ability to shut off the water quickly can prevent significant water damage. A slow drip from a cracked pipe may not seem like an immediate crisis, but over time, it can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and increased water bills. In contrast, a sudden gush from a broken pipe can saturate furniture, flooring, and electrical appliances within minutes, posing a risk to both property and personal safety. Corrosion or mineral buildup may cause it to seize, rendering it useless in an emergency. Homeowners should periodically exercise the valve by turning it on and off to keep the mechanism from binding. If you encounter any issues, such as difficulty turning the valve or signs of leakage around it, it is prudent to have a professional plumber address the problem promptly.
